Al-Halqi: Int’l policy shift has positive impact on the world

DAMASCUS,(ST)_Prime Minister has said that the current changes in international policy will have positive impact on peoples in the region and around the world and on reaching a solution to the crisis in Syria.

Dr. Wael al-Halqi, who was speaking today in the cabinet’s weekly session, clarified that the emergence of a new international pole comprising- Russia, China, Iran and the BRICS countries- restores stability and balance to the international arena.

He sees that the changes in international policy will positively  have  an effect on reaching a solution to the crisis in his country through the national dialogue among the Syrians and under Syria’s leadership without foreign dictations and intervention.

Al-Halqi called on the international bodies that sponsor terrorism in Syria to immediately stop supporting terrorists and their influx from the neighboring countries.

“Strategic victory’

At the beginning of the session, the premier congratulated Iran on the ‘historic’ deal with the representatives of the so-called P5+1 nations – the US, the UK, Russia, France , China and Germany- on the Iranian Nuke program.

“The deal rehabilitated the international charters and peoples’ right to self-determination. It is a ‘historic’ and ‘strategic’ victory for the resistance axis in the region,” al-Halqi was quoted on the official news agency as saying.

The agency noted that today-session also dealt with the economic situation in the country plus the Polio vaccination campaign.

The cabinet approved a bill on electronic transaction that aims at facilitating trade and opening doors to foreign markets.
